Objectives

This course represents the intermediate aspects of the theoretical knowledge and practical skills required by all persons wishing to work in the air conditioning and/or the refrigeration fields. This course forms the second stage and as such is imperative that all persons complete the course. Technology 3 and the diploma course follow. The course has a full theory and practical component in our accredited workshop.

Outcomes

Upon successful completion of this course the student will have the understanding of the intermediate aspects of refrigeration and air conditioning. Superheat measurement, setting and the importance there of, sub-cooling, LP and HP Pressure switch setting determination and actual setting on an installation, Basic refrigeration commissioning techniques and procedures. Types of refrigeration systems, types of air conditioning systems, evaporative coolers, air conditioning components, heating, critical charging, compressor testing, fault finding, drives and couplings. Students have the opportunity to further their studies. The range of study progresses through air conditioning and refrigeration to and including large central plants.

Example of Skills

Fault finding / basic commissioning / procedures on walk in fridges / freezer / air con units / critical charging / humidity / recovery of refrigerants/ servicing/ belt drives tensioning and alignment / couplings / bearings / various systems and their operation and application / controls and safety devices / vapour barriers.
